DigiForce Summer School
July 21 – July 30
The DigiForce Summer School will take place at NOVA School of Law, in Lisbon, between the 21st and 30th of July 2026.
It is open to participants worldwide, and aimed primarily at law students, PhD candidates or young legal practitioners (within 10 years of completing their law training).
Applications are open until 17 April, more information here.
The Summer School consists of four parts, taught by leading researchers in EU administrative law, fundamental rights, law & tech, digital regulation and artificial intelligence:
